Fireplace Insert Comparison for Ohio Homes

A fireplace that looks inviting but leaves the living room chilly can be frustrating, especially during a northeast Ohio winter. A fireplace insert comparison helps homeowners look beyond the appearance of a new unit and focus on what matters at home: dependable heat, safe venting, daily convenience, operating cost, and the condition of the existing chimney.

An insert is a self-contained heating appliance installed into an existing masonry or factory-built fireplace opening. Unlike an open fireplace, it is designed to capture more heat and send it into the room rather than up the chimney. The right choice depends on how you use the space, what fuel you prefer, and whether your chimney can safely support the appliance.

Fireplace Insert Comparison: Start With How You Heat

The most useful question is not which insert is best overall. It is which insert is right for your household. A wood-burning insert may suit a homeowner who wants meaningful supplemental heat and enjoys tending a fire. A gas insert can be a strong fit for someone who wants quick warmth with minimal daily work. A pellet insert offers thermostat-controlled heat from a renewable fuel source, but it relies on electricity and regular cleaning.

Before selecting a model, consider whether the insert will heat one gathering room, reduce the load on a central furnace, or provide heat during a power outage. Also consider who will operate it. A household comfortable with storing firewood and handling ash has different needs than someone who wants to press a wall switch after work.

The fireplace itself is only one part of the decision. The chimney, flue, hearth, electrical access, gas supply, clearances, and masonry condition all affect what can be installed safely. An on-site inspection should come before choosing a unit based solely on a showroom display or online photo.

Wood-Burning Inserts: Strong Heat With Hands-On Care

A properly selected wood insert can produce substantial, steady heat and turn an underperforming open fireplace into a practical heating source. Modern EPA-certified models burn more efficiently and cleanly than older wood stoves and conventional open hearths. For homeowners with access to properly seasoned firewood, wood heat can also help reduce reliance on other heating sources.

The trade-off is participation. Firewood must be split, stored dry, carried inside, and burned correctly. The fire needs attention, ash must be removed, and the glass and firebox require routine care. Wet or poorly seasoned wood creates more smoke, less heat, and more creosote in the venting system.

Most wood insert installations require a correctly sized, continuous stainless-steel liner running from the appliance to the top of the chimney. The liner is not an optional accessory added for appearance. It helps the appliance draft properly and keeps combustion byproducts contained within a system designed for that purpose. The chimney also needs to be structurally sound, protected from water entry, and inspected before installation.

A wood insert may be the better choice when heat output, fuel independence, and the experience of a real wood fire matter most. During an outage, many non-electric wood inserts can continue providing heat, although any blower will not run without power. Confirm the specific model’s operating requirements before assuming it will serve as emergency heat.

Wood insert considerations

Wood inserts ask for the greatest amount of homeowner involvement, but they can deliver the most traditional hearth experience. Plan for annual professional inspection and sweeping, proper fuel storage, and attention to safe burning habits. Never treat a new insert as a way to avoid chimney maintenance. Higher efficiency changes the system, but it does not eliminate the need for service.

Gas Inserts: Convenience, Control, and Clean Operation

Gas fireplace inserts are popular with homeowners who want a dependable flame without handling wood or ash. They start quickly, offer adjustable heat settings, and often operate with a wall switch, remote, or thermostat. Many models have a standing pilot or battery backup option that can allow basic operation during a power outage, though capabilities vary by unit.

A direct-vent gas insert uses a sealed venting arrangement that brings in outside combustion air and sends exhaust outdoors. This design can be an excellent option for comfort and indoor air quality when installed according to manufacturer requirements. It also means the existing fireplace and chimney must be evaluated for proper liner routing, termination, clearances, and condition.

Gas is generally the lowest-maintenance choice from day to day, but it is not maintenance-free. Logs, burners, valves, ignition components, and venting should be inspected and cleaned by a qualified technician. Dust, pet hair, spider webs, and component wear can affect ignition, flame appearance, and safe performance. A gas odor, delayed ignition, soot, or a flame that looks unusually yellow should prompt service rather than continued use.

Gas inserts are well suited to homeowners who prioritize convenience, controlled supplemental heat, and a clean appearance. Their main limitations are fuel availability, installation cost where a gas line is not already present, and the fact that they do not provide the same wood-burning experience or fuel flexibility as a wood insert.

Pellet Inserts: Efficient Heat That Needs Power

Pellet inserts burn compressed wood pellets that feed automatically from a hopper into the burn pot. They can provide consistent, thermostat-controlled heat with less manual fire tending than a wood insert. For some homeowners, this balance of renewable fuel and automated operation is appealing.

However, pellet appliances use electricity for the auger, fan, and controls. Without a battery backup or generator, they generally stop during a power outage. They also need dry pellet storage and a reliable local fuel supply, particularly before the heating season. The burn pot and ash areas require regular cleaning, while the venting and appliance should receive professional annual service.

Pellet inserts can make sense for a homeowner who wants more automation than cordwood provides and is willing to maintain the appliance on schedule. They are less ideal for households seeking simple outage heat or those who prefer the near-instant operation of gas.

Compare the Chimney, Not Just the Insert

A new appliance cannot compensate for a deteriorated chimney. Water intrusion, cracked crowns, loose brick, damaged flashing, missing caps, and failed mortar joints can all affect the safety and longevity of an insert installation. In older homes across Trumbull, Mahoning, and Mercer counties, the chimney may have years of weather exposure that needs attention before a liner or venting system is added.

An inspection should identify the fireplace opening dimensions, chimney height, flue layout, combustibles near the installation area, and masonry concerns. It should also determine whether the existing flue is appropriate for the intended appliance. A wood insert liner, gas vent system, and pellet venting system have different sizing and installation requirements. One is not interchangeable with another.

This is where an honest recommendation matters. Sometimes a chimney needs a cap, crown repair, repointing, or flashing work first. Sometimes the fireplace opening needs modification. In other cases, an insert is not the most practical option for the home. Clear findings allow you to address the real issue instead of spending money on a unit that cannot perform as intended.

Cost, Efficiency, and Long-Term Value

Purchase price is only one line in the budget. Include installation labor, chimney liner or venting, electrical work, gas piping if needed, hearth changes, masonry repairs, permits where required, and ongoing maintenance. A lower-priced unit can become the more expensive option if the installation needs were overlooked.

Efficiency should also be viewed realistically. A high-efficiency insert can reduce wasted heat, but savings depend on how often it runs, the size and insulation of the home, fuel prices, thermostat settings, and whether it replaces other heat or simply adds comfort in one room. Oversizing is not a shortcut to better performance. An oversized wood insert may lead to low, smoldering fires, while an oversized gas unit can make a room uncomfortably hot before heat reaches other areas.

For wood and pellet appliances, responsible fuel use supports both performance and environmental stewardship. Burn dry, appropriate fuel, follow the manufacturer’s instructions, and keep the venting system clean. For every fuel type, carbon monoxide alarms and smoke alarms should be working, correctly located, and tested regularly.

Choose With a Full-System Inspection

The best insert is the one that fits your heating goals and works safely with the fireplace and chimney you already have. A professional evaluation can clarify whether wood, gas, or pellet makes the most sense, what liner or venting is required, and whether masonry repairs should be completed first.
